About the Role
The Procurement Category Manager will lead the strategic management of indirect spend across the IT category, ensuring Harrods consistently sources goods and services that deliver quality and value. Reporting to the Head of Procurement, this role is accountable for driving commercial advantage through robust category strategies, data-driven spend analysis, and exceptional stakeholder engagement.
You will build and manage strong relationships with key suppliers, leveraging robust supplier relationship management frameworks to deliver innovation, sustainability, risk mitigation, and continuous performance improvement. Working closely with senior stakeholders across the business, you will lead end-to-end procurement activities, including market analysis, tender processes, commercial negotiations, and contract management, while championing procurement best practices and driving organisational change. You will also be responsible for delivering savings targets across CAPEX and OPEX spend, ensuring compliance with company policies and governance requirements, and confidently influencing stakeholders and suppliers to achieve strategic business objectives.
About You
You will bring strong experience in IT procurement, with a solid understanding of category management, strategic sourcing, and Supplier Relationship Management (SRM). You'll have excellent commercial and negotiation skills, experience using procurement or sourcing systems, and be confident analysing data and presenting insights using tools such as Excel, PowerPoint, and Word. Retail sector experience is advantageous but not essential.
You will be an effective communicator with the ability to influence stakeholders and manage supplier relationships. A good understanding of procurement governance, contract management, risk management, and compliance is essential, alongside a commitment to ethical sourcing. Highly organised and detail-oriented, you'll be comfortable managing multiple priorities and working independently with minimal supervision.
